def save_to_bangumi_download_queue(data):
    """
    list[dict]
    dict:{
    name;str, keyword you use when search
    title:str, title of episode
    episode:int, episode of bangumi
    download:str, link to download
    }
    :param data:
    :return:
    """
    queue = []
    for i in data:
        download = Download(status=STATUS_NOT_DOWNLOAD,
                            name=i['name'],
                            title=i['title'],
                            episode=i['episode'],
                            download=i['download'])
        download.save()
        queue.append(download)

    return queue

def update(name, download=None, not_ignore=False):
    result = {
        'status': 'info',
        'message': '',
        'data': {
            'updated': [],
            'downloaded': []
        }
    }

    ignore = not bool(not_ignore)
    print_info('marking bangumi status ...')
    now = int(time.time())
    for i in Followed.get_all_followed():
        if i['updated_time'] and int(i['updated_time'] + 86400) < now:
            followed_obj = Followed.get(bangumi_name=i['bangumi_name'])
            followed_obj.status = STATUS_FOLLOWED
            followed_obj.save()

    for script in ScriptRunner().scripts:
        obj = script.Model().obj
        if obj.updated_time and int(obj.updated_time + 86400) < now:
            obj.status = STATUS_FOLLOWED
            obj.save()

    print_info('updating bangumi data ...')
    website.fetch(save=True, group_by_weekday=False)
    print_info('updating subscriptions ...')
    download_queue = []

    if download:
        if not name:
            print_warning('No specified bangumi, ignore `--download` option')
        if len(name) > 1:
            print_warning(
                'Multiple specified bangumi, ignore `--download` option')

    if not name:
        updated_bangumi_obj = Followed.get_all_followed()
    else:
        updated_bangumi_obj = []
        for i in name:
            try:
                f = Followed.get(bangumi_name=i).__dict__['_data']
                updated_bangumi_obj.append(f)
            except DoesNotExist:
                pass

    runner = ScriptRunner()
    script_download_queue = runner.run()

    for subscribe in updated_bangumi_obj:
        print_info('fetching %s ...' % subscribe['bangumi_name'])
        try:
            bangumi_obj = Bangumi.get(name=subscribe['bangumi_name'])
        except Bangumi.DoesNotExist:
            print_error('Bangumi<{0}> does not exists.'.format(
                subscribe['bangumi_name']),
                        exit_=False)
            continue
        try:
            followed_obj = Followed.get(bangumi_name=subscribe['bangumi_name'])
        except Followed.DoesNotExist:
            print_error('Bangumi<{0}> is not followed.'.format(
                subscribe['bangumi_name']),
                        exit_=False)
            continue

        episode, all_episode_data = website.get_maximum_episode(
            bangumi=bangumi_obj, ignore_old_row=ignore, max_page=1)

        if (episode.get('episode') > subscribe['episode']) or (len(name) == 1
                                                               and download):
            if len(name) == 1 and download:
                episode_range = download
            else:
                episode_range = range(subscribe['episode'] + 1,
                                      episode.get('episode', 0) + 1)
                print_success('%s updated, episode: %d' %
                              (subscribe['bangumi_name'], episode['episode']))
                followed_obj.episode = episode['episode']
                followed_obj.status = STATUS_UPDATED
                followed_obj.updated_time = int(time.time())
                followed_obj.save()
                result['data']['updated'].append({
                    'bangumi':
                    subscribe['bangumi_name'],
                    'episode':
                    episode['episode']
                })

            for i in episode_range:
                for epi in all_episode_data:
                    if epi['episode'] == i:
                        download_queue.append(epi)
                        break

    if download is not None:
        result['data']['downloaded'] = download_queue
        download_prepare(download_queue)
        download_prepare(script_download_queue)
        print_info('Re-downloading ...')
        download_prepare(
            Download.get_all_downloads(status=STATUS_NOT_DOWNLOAD))

    return result
